House For Sale £1,350,000
Guildford Lodge Drive, East Horsley, Leatherhead KT24


Description
A substantial 1930's character family home in South facing grounds located in this hidden gem of a Private Road.

4 Bedrooms - 3 Bath/Shower Rooms - 4 Receptions - Kitchen/Breakfast Room - Detached Home Office/Studio - 1/4 Acre South Facing Gardens - Stone's Throw to Shops - Within The Raleigh & Howard of Effingham Catchments - 1 Mile to Station - No Onward Chain

Set beyond a gated entrance and passing under the porte cochere of possibly one of the most notable Landmark buildings in the village, are just 7 homes in this aspirational private road setting, which very few even know exists...

The house itself is a classically styled 1930's home built by fh Chown, with the signature detailing to the aesthetics which include eyebrow roof lines flanking a central Tudor gable, with brick dental course and a freestyled brick and chalk stone chimney to the rear.

Again, each room enjoys a signature of its own, whether it be a focal point fireplace, lovely views over the gardens or a triple aspect, connected with the hub of the home being the hand built kitchen/breakfast room with iroko worktops, cleverly laid out into two distinct areas complete with range style cooker and banquette seating for the whole family.

On the first floor there are 4 well proportioned double bedrooms all with views over the gardens and two of which are either double or triple aspect. There are also two bath/shower rooms of which one is en-suite to the main bedroom, with a very useful 3rd shower room on the ground floor.

Outside, the property is graced with ample parking on the sweeping gravel carriage driveway with gated side access to the rear gardens. With the overall plot measuring a little over 1/4 acre, the rear gardens are also a notable feature. Extending to over 130' in length and facing due South, there is a large terrace across the rear of the house ideal for summer entertaining, with the remainder of the gardens principally laid to lawn. Within the garden is an incredibly useful detached Work From Home Office/Art Studio which could also be utilised as a home Gym if so desired. There is also a brick built implement store and screened by conifers at the bottom of the garden is the 'working end' of the outside spaces which include a substantial timber shed and useful composting area.
